Dr. Amr Tolba is a leading researcher at the intersection of artificial intelligence, the Internet of Things (IoT), and healthcare robotics, with a particular focus on advancing Healthcare 4.0. His work is distinguished by pioneering contributions to secure, intelligent, and human-centric robotic systems. Dr. Tolba has developed innovative frameworks for heart stroke prediction using artificial neural network-driven federated learning, a paper that has garnered 39 citations for its impact on smart healthcare diagnostics. He also introduced a groundbreaking IoST-enabled robotic arm control system that uses minimal flex sensors and Gaussian Mixture Models for abnormality prediction, earning 21 citations for its potential to assist individuals with limb impairments. His research extends to secure telesurgery operations, where he has orchestrated deep learning-based garlic routing architectures to protect sensitive surgical data in real-time IoT applications. Additionally, Dr. Tolba has advanced human-robot interactions in smart city applications and developed efficient control methods for spider-like medical robots using capsule neural networks. With a growing citation record and a portfolio of work that seamlessly integrates AI, IoT, and robotics, Dr. Tolba is shaping the future of dependable, intelligent, and secure healthcare technologies.
